Mark Patrick Manns
Mark Patrick Manns, 56, of Ostrander journeyed from this life to the next on Sunday (Feb. 19, 2012) with his loved ones by his side.
Mark was born June 9, 1955, to Dorothy and Joseph Manns. Mark was a Dublin High School graduate and attended Mesa Arizona Community College and The Ohio State University. He was an extremely talented home builder and craftsman. He was an avid Jeep enthusiast and especially enjoyed the Willy’s Jeep. In his younger days, Mark raced motor cross and had a lifetime membership as a mud dober. Mark was a compassionate, kind man that valued his family above all else. Mark held a deep reverence for the beauty of the Mill Creek area where he resided with his wife and two children for nearly 30 years.
